Treatment can be helpful for a vast array of psychological health conditions. In this article, we’ll check out 10 different conditions that people may have and how treatment can assist.
Depression is a common mental health condition that impacts countless individuals worldwide. Therapy can help by providing a safe space to speak about your emotions and sensations. A therapist can assist you identify unfavorable thought patterns and habits and deal with you to develop coping strategies and positive habits.
Stress and anxiety is another common mental health condition that can be debilitating. Treatment can help by teaching you relaxation techniques, such as deep breathing and mindfulness, and working with you to establish coping strategies to manage anxiety triggers.
PTSD, or trauma, is a mental health condition that can establish after experiencing or witnessing a terrible occasion. Therapy can assist by supplying a safe area to process the trauma and establish coping techniques to manage the symptoms of PTSD.
OCD, or obsessive-compulsive disorder, is a mental health condition characterized by compulsive behaviors and intrusive thoughts. Treatment can assist by teaching you how to determine and manage these thoughts and habits, along with develop coping techniques to manage the signs of OCD. Revenu Qubec Betterhelp

Seeing a therapist can have various benefits for a person’s mental health and wellness. Here are a few of the benefits of seeing a therapist from a mental point of view:
Increased self-awareness
One of the primary advantages of seeing a therapist is increased self-awareness. A therapist can help you determine patterns in your thoughts, habits, and emotions, along with the underlying beliefs and values that drive them. By ending up being more familiar with these patterns, you can get a much deeper understanding of yourself and your inspirations, which can cause personal growth and development.

Decreased signs of mental illness
Treatment can also be effective in lowering symptoms of mental disorder, such as anxiety, anxiety, and trauma (PTSD). Therapists utilize evidence-based treatments,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ior modification (DBT), and eye motion des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R), to assist individuals handle symptoms and enhance their overall lifestyle.
